We want to do a "Restart Accounting" for our church so we can establish a more suitable Chart of Accounts. The previous Chart of Accounts is just not meeting our needs.

But when we do the Restart, our new Chart of Accounts will have a new account numbering system that will not match up to or connect to our old Contribution Funds list. We need to update our Contribution Funds list, also.

QUESTION: Is this possible, or a good way to update our Accounting records, while retaining our old Membership Module data ? :

1.) Make a backup file of all old data as of December 2014

2.) Restart Accounting (Fund Accounting, Payroll, A/P, etc. modules) in the new 2015 file,

3.) Delete the old Contribution data in the new 2015 file,

4.) Go back through the Contribution Module setup (so we can update, simplify, improve the Contribution Funds list, making the necessary account connections with the new Chart of Accounts),

5.) Retain the previous Membership Module data (with its specifications of Members' contribution Envelope numbers)...

Is it possible to do a Restart this way ? I was concerned about losing the Membership Module data in this type of a Restart.

A restart of Accounting has no effect on either Membership or Contributions data. The only issue is after you finish the Accounting restart, you'll have to go into the Maintain Contribution Funds in the Contributions module, and adjust each INCOME account listed under each Contribution Fund.

NeilZ wrote:The only issue is after you finish the Accounting restart, you'll have to go into the Maintain Contribution Funds in the Contributions module, and adjust each INCOME account listed under each Contribution Fund.
Actually, this will be addressed in the Contributions Income section of the Accounting Setup Assistant. It lists each of your existing funds and asks if they are unrestricted, temporarily restricted, or permanently restricted. Label them properly in that step and the income, release, and equity accounts will be set up and assigned to the Contribution Funds for you.
